Edmond DE Rothschild Holding S.A. bought a new stake in HubSpot, Inc. (NYSE:HUBS - Free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und bought 354,042 shares of the software maker's stock, valued at approximately $64,616,000. HubSpot accounts for about 0.9% of Edmond DE Rothschild Holding S.A.'s portfolio, making the stock its 27th biggest position. Edmond DE Rothschild Holding S.A. owned 0.71% of HubSpot at the end of the most recent quarter.

HubSpot Stock Up 6.8%
HubSpot stock opened at $241.60 on Thursday.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$207.56 and a 200 day simple moving average of $223.86. The stock has a market capitalization of $12.05 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 85.37, a P/E/G ratio of 2.31 and a beta of 1.19. HubSpot, Inc. has a 12-month low of $169.63 and a 12-month high of $525.51.
HubSpot (NYSE:HUBS -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, August 5th. The software maker reported $3.26 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$3.02 by $0.24. HubSpot had a net margin of 4.26% and a return on equity of 8.66%. The firm had revenue of $911.74 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$898.31 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$2.19 EPS. The company's revenue was up 19.8% on a year-over-year basis. HubSpot has set its FY 2026 guidance at 13.230-13.310 EPS and its Q3 2026 guidance at 3.250-3.270 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that HubSpot, Inc. will post 4.54 EPS for the current year.

HubSpot Company Profile
(
Free Report)
HubSpot, Inc is a software company that develops a cloud-based customer relationship management (CRM) platform designed to help organizations attract, engage and delight customers. Its primary business activities center on providing integrated marketing, sales and customer service tools that support inbound marketing strategies, content management, lead nurturing, sales automation and customer support workflows.
The company's product suite is organized around modular “hubs” built on a central CRM: Marketing Hub, Sales Hub, Service Hub, CMS Hub and Operations Hub.
